#51bb10 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#51bb10 is composed of 31.8% red, 73.3% green and 6.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 56.7% cyan, 0% magenta, 91.4% yellow and 26.7% black. It has a hue angle of 97.2 degrees, a saturation of 84.2% and a lightness of 39.8%. #51bb10 color hex could be obtained by blending #a2ff20 with #007700. Closest websafe color is: #66cc00.

#51bb10 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#51bb10 has RGB values of R:81, G:187, B:16 and CMYK values of C:0.57, M:0, Y:0.91, K:0.27. Its decimal value is 5356304.

Shades and Tints of #51bb10
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#030601 is the darkest color, while #f7fef3 is the lightest one.

Tones of #51bb10
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#646d5e is the less saturated color, while #4dcb00 is the most saturated one.
